<p>I started training hard. Well documented and I found books and references that guided me during the 50 days. 7 days a week, running 3 days 5 to 8 km. A strength and flexibility working days, the next day was a spinning alternating cardiovascular activity, rest a day and usually on Sunday, conducted the week long race. I gradually reaching 12, 16, 18 km &#8230; The race day, the Bogota Half Marathon was held on August 2, 2009, was ready.</p>

<p>More than 30 000 people gathered on a sunny morning in Bogota. It was 930am when I entered the Plaza de Bolivar. I was quiet because I felt that I had prepared well. Had breakfast 2 hours before: a banana, a slice of rye bread and coffee. During the week before the race had started eating 10% more carbohydrates &#8211; rice, bread, pasta, integrated whole. I was well hydrated the night before and in the morning.</p>
<p>I enrolled in the open category. This category is divided into colors, depending on the speed with which distance is performed. My start was yellow, for those who are delayed 1 hour 45 min to 2 hours 15 min completing 21kms. Let&#8217;s say I&#8217;m not a runner, but my idea was not to win by any means. <p>Skating is a sport that requires a perfect balance between mind and body while high sensory-motor coordination that engages, develops and sharpens the sense of balance and skating espacio.El management is a blend of strength, skill and resistance, which is very important to the action of the muscles and  joints to give the flexion and extension</p>
<p>This sport for half an hour at a constant speed and moderate causes burn around 300 calories and even better, if at an intense pace can double the amount. Skating provides the same aerobic benefits offered by the run and with a more moderate physical impact, because the foot does not hit the ground  repeatedly, but slides.<br />
Skating can also help us to get some legs firm and shapely . But not only the  legs and buttocks are benefited to skate, because the upper extremities and shoulders exercise with natural arm movement that begins to skate with greater intensity, and generally throughout the body improves muscle tone, and also is working abdominals, waist, back, arms and shoulders. All this because skating is an aerobic sport that helps burn excess stored fat in these areas .</p>
<p>Besides helping to maintain the shape and burn calories , skating also activates blood circulation improving the arrival of nutrients to cells  throughout the  body and therefore,  improving the health and wellbeing. It also improves stamina, increases motor skills, increases muscle strength, strengthen the  lungs and heart  and gives a lot of energy, which  can be helpful for reducing stress levels .</p>

<p>This time I bring you a few tips to make your tennis serves are most effective. The idea is that by following these steps and over a period of three months achieve a significant improvement in your tennis serve, yes, as long as you are consistent and do the exercises I propose here.</p>
<p>To improve your tennis serve I recommend the following:</p>
<p>Step 1)  Book a tennis court for you one hour a week designed to exercise your tennis serve ONLY</p>
<p>Step 2)  takes about 30 tennis balls around, if you do not have borrowed that amount you could lose your tennis club or your tennis instructor.</p>
<p>Step 3)  The first 15 minutes before entering the track I recommend you do a few warm up exercises. Remember to warm shoulders, Munera, waist, etc &#8230;</p>
<p>Step 4)  After you make your warm up and stretching, the first 5 to 10 minutes after entering the track you put your feet in position tennis serve (foot back parallel to the bottom line and  looking forward foot to the right pole the network) all without racket and your dominant hand (right for righties) are going to throw balls into the box that suits you pull like  you&#8217;re throwing stones  from behind your head.</p>
<p>Step 5)  You&#8217;re going to do about 5-10 min the  kick-ball and tennis racquet without trying to make the exercise as perfect as possible or slowmotion slow motion. Remember to note that both arms be coordinated to have the continental grip, pronation do, make the imaginary point of impact with the arm fully stretched, accompanying the blow to the termination, etc &#8230;</p>
<p>Step 6)  You&#8217;re going to start taking the first set of 25 balls to a single box slowly make the movement focused on technically good.</p>
<p>Step 7)  The following number of balls you realize the tennis serve two balls and two balls one box to another box. That is going to remove the two balls 25 balls alternating each frame just worrying because between the ball into the box serve.</p>
<p>Step 8.  Now the next set of 25 balls are going to focus on those two balls at each table will both at the same corner kick box.</p>
<p>Step 9)  The next series will you get two balls at the  same picture as before but now a ball goes into a corner and the second goes to the opposite corner. Here are working addresses ball.</p>
<p>Step 10)  After working with the tennis serve low average power ball work addresses the following series now going to work with a throw of  power and a weak second serve but surely. The objective here is that you always between the second tennis serve and not commit a double fault.</p>
<p>Step 11)  This step only if you made ​​it a relatively advanced player. You will perform the last two sets with a flat first serve and a  second with much effect either cut or topspin (note: remember throw the ball to the right place depending on whether the serve is cut or topspin)</p>
<p>If you perform this exercise with one day per week recorded during three months notice improvement in your  tennis serve .</p>

<p>If you want to learn to play tennis , there are many options open to  you, but getting a private trainer or coach tennis is the easiest way to learn. Once you&#8217;ve gotten to the private tennis instructor, your first lessons will learn the rules of the game. Before you start playing, the instructor will review the basics of the game. You will learn the standard structure of the game, including the scoreboard and keep count as you&#8217;re playing a game. The instructor will also review the rules for playing &#8220;double&#8221;. This is a variant of tennis in which two teams of two play together against each other. Once you&#8217;ve learned the rules of the game and how to count the points, then go to the court with the instructor or trainer.  This is where you will learn to &#8220;lob&#8221; the ball back and forth, which  is just hitting the tennis ball back and forth over the network, allowing you to go grabbing your paddle and trust with the court. Also learn the proper techniques on how to hold the racket properly and find the hilt that best suits you. If a person starts to play tennis and develop bad habits from the beginning, it will be difficult to re-learn the proper way to hold the racket. Then the instructor will show you how to  run the service . One of the major tennis strokes and fundamental to start a game. This is sometimes a difficult skill to master, since you have to throw the ball with one hand, release it, then tell your swing so you can hit the ball hard, sending it across the network and across the opposite field, or next to your opponent. In addition to learn how to calculate your serve to fall into the box on the side of your opponent.</p>
